In this episode… To grow an online business, e-commerce entrepreneurs need to focus on three foolproof methods: increasing customer numbers, increasing the value of transactions, and increasing the frequency of transactions. Most e-commerce sellers pursue traditional advertising in the hope that it will raise brand awareness. But serial entrepreneur Mitch Russo advocates free advertising using PR methods such as podcast features, press releases, and news articles. However, don't expect instant results — it could take 30 or more appearances to experience sales conversions. Growing a fanbase helps immensely with boosting transaction frequencies. Mitch recommends creating effective communications and content using platforms like YouTube, TikTok, and Instagram to build a loyal following. LinkedIn and email campaigns are also effective channels to reach your target audience. Mitch Russo was the lead guitar player for his high school rock band. Besides being the best way ever to meet girls, it taught him how to build, run and promote a business. His band; Absolutely Free, was the highest paid high school rock band in his school district, making over $500 a night, and that was in 1970. In 1985, Mitch co-founded Timeslips Corp, which grew to become the largest time tracking Software Company in the world. In 1994, Timeslips Corp was sold to Sage, plc. While at Sage, Mitch went on to run all of Sage U.S. as Chief Operating Officer, a division with 300 people with a market cap in excess of $100M. Mitch Russo was nominated for Inc. Magazine’s “Entrepreneur of the Year” on two separate occasions, 1989 and 1991. Mitch Russo joined long time friend Chet Holmes and Tony Robbins and together created Business Breakthroughs, Int'l, a company serving thousands of businesses a year with coaching, consulting and training services. Mitch was the President and CEO. After the untimely death of Chet, Mitch left Business Breakthroughs to help others build their business as a consultant specializing in working with call centers with large volume lead flow and helping coaching organizations scale. In 2015, Mitch published “The Invisible Organization” which is the CEO’s guide to transitioning a traditional brick and mortar company into a fully virtual organization. In 2017, Mitch launched a SaaS platform called The Results Breakthrough Network, to match entrepreneurs for the purpose of holding regular accountability sessions to complete their goals and be successful. In 2018, Mitch published his second book: Power Tribes – How Certification Can Explode Your Business. Mitch’s Podcast: Your First Thousand Clients, focuses on discovering the secrets of success from business owners who have served 1000 clients or more. TODAY, Mitch helps his clients build recurring revenue streams by using his proprietary certification training and podcasts with super smart business owners. Click To Tweet Show Notes: Here's a fun question for you…If you could go back in time with whom would you like to spend a day with? Steve Jobs. That's my favourite person in the world. Elon Musk is one too but Steve Jobs, I think he did the impossible, I think he did it as a person who came into this world with both gifts and deficits. He overcame them and found a way to build something amazing. What stops most entrepreneurs from breaking through and being successful? Entrepreneurs who break through appears to be overnight successes. I think most people don't realize how hard it is to find something of value, find a way to present it to others and also find a way to begin selling it successfully. Entrepreneurship is a journey and it's never a single action or a single thing. It's a process, a journey and it requires many different discipline. That's why I love entrepreneurship so much. I believe it is one of the most creative ways to challenge yourself, to build wealth and to build community. What is success for you? It is different for different people. It can money, like what a lot of persons think of. But success can also be satisfaction, the joy of doing the work you love. What do you say to those who are fearful of succeeding, fearful of criticism/ fearful of attention? Criticism is strongest from inside. Most of what people are listening to is that voice that's inside. For many people that voice tells them that they are not smart enough, that they are not good enough. It's the ability to fight that back, the ability to recognize that is part of human nature protection system and overcome it and understanding that it is not protecting us at all. It is the same mechanism designed to keep us safe in the jungle. It is not the mechanism today that is valuable. The best thing to do is to try and overcome those feelings and if everybody else has comments like that, like you, you simply disregard them because they are simply not valid. Was there ever a point you had to face your own demon of fear? Yes. It comes up to this day. Facing one's demo is a big category. To me what demons are is those tiny little voices that say, "oh no you can't do that", or 'you're not good enough or there are smarter people in the world that you, why do you think you can go off do that that. Those are the demons that haunt too many of us. In an entrepreneurial life when you're mostly alone or working with a small team, that's when the demons get to speak the loudest. I think it is our job as entrepreneurs to overcome those feelings and those voices and instead focus only on outcomes. What was starting, running and then selling your successful company like? I think, like many good ideas, that materialize in this world, that idea did not start as the idea that materialize. It started as a different idea. It (the software company) started as an idea to keep track of time so I could deduct my computer from my taxes. Back then, computers were thought of as toys by the IRS. My partner and I agreed that this was good idea and we built an entire to keep track of time to make sure we could deduct them from our taxes. Just about the time we quit our jobs and ready to launch, the IRS relaxed their ruling on that very thing. Without any notice,

[spp-tweet tweet="What I have is not who I am, who I am creates what I have - Mitch Russo"] Mitch Russo started working as an Electrical Engineer at Digital Equipment Corp in Maynard, MA. I migrated to application engineering for Mostek (a semiconductor company) and then to selling chips to large and small companies alike. In 1985, Mitch entered the software business as the founder of Timeslips Corp (sold to Sage Plc) after creating the largest network of Certified Consultants in the software industry, helping Intuit Corp create their own Certified Quickbooks Accountant Network as well. After selling his company, Mitch then ran Sage Plc in the US as the COO, with over 300 staff. Moving back to Boston, Mitch then found himself involved in the VC community, first as an advisor to startups and then as the CEO of the largest furniture shopping site early in 2000; FurnitureFan.com. In 2007, responding to his friend Chet Holmes request to help solve a problem, Mitch Russo became involved with his business. Working with Tony Robbins & Chet Holmes as CEO of Business Breakthroughs, Int’l[caption id="attachment_2435" align="alignleft" width="193"]https://menofabundance.com/wp-content/uploads/2016/12/Mitch-Tony-610x378.jpg () Tony Robbins and Mitch posing for a photo at a Business Mastery Event[/caption] Later Mitch Russo ran a $25M business from his spare bedroom converted to a home office. He learned so much from his dearest friend Chet. More than anyone, Chet prepared Mitch for what he does today. Later, Mitch went on to write an Amazon #1 Best Seller: http://amzn.to/1RBsMOP (The Invisible Organization), which is a detailed blueprint explaining step-by-step how to transform a traditional physical infrastructure into a virtual powerhouse of a company.
